From October 9 to 10, 2002, traditional Chinese artist and Australian Falun Gong practitioner Zhang Cuiying held an exhibition of her paintings in Dallas City Hall. The visitors enjoyed the beautiful paintings and were also able to understand the truth of the persecution of Falun Gong in China. All were shocked at the facts of the persecution. Several media teams covered the event and reported immediately.
Zhang Cuiying exhibited several dozen paintings in the show. Her elegant Chinese paintings with deep artistic implications made visitors sense the richness and broadness of Chinese culture. Many visitors had their photos taken in front of the paintings. Because the exhibition was during the week, many people came to city hall and stopped to see the paintings. They also picked up truth-clarifying literature to read.
The practitioners also exhibited a photo of the artist when she returned to Australia after being released from a Chinese prison. The photo shows Zhang Cuiying wearing a T-shirt on which she wrote a poem with her own blood having nothing else to write with. Beside the photo was a sketch showing she was tortured in prison. The artist’s personal experience made the kind-hearted American people surprised and indignant. Many visitors signed the postcards to President Bush to express their condemnation of Jiang’s regime and to ask President Bush to support Falun Gong practitioners’ human rights and help end the persecution. One girl left a short letter expressing her understanding and appreciation of Truthfulness, Compassion, and Forbearance.
Reporters from both Chinese and English media came to interview Zhang Cuiying, including Dallas’s largest newspaper Dallas Morning News, as well as the Chinese newspaper World Journal, and the Epoch Times. Some reporters from a radio broadcasting station covering other news came across the painting exhibition and interviewed the artist right away. The interview was broadcast immediately. Five minutes later, a gentleman hurried in to see the paintings. He told the practitioners that he came after he heard the news report form the radio broadcasting station.
